Pho — Restaurant in Cambridge

You can find Pho on Wheeler Street in Cambridge, just outside the city centre. It’s a straightforward spot known for its authentic Vietnamese pho, made with slow-brewed broth and house-made noodles every day. People come here for quick lunches, evening meals after work or classes, or relaxed dinners with friends. The reliable menu and consistent quality make it a solid choice when you want something dependable without the fuss.

About The Venue

Pho is a restaurant on Wheeler Street in Cambridge, located just outside the city centre. The space has an open layout that works well for solo diners or small groups. Minimalist design with neutral tones, simple wooden tables, and clean lines focuses on function over decoration. There are no historical features or standout architectural details, the place stands on its consistent service and core offering: Vietnamese pho. Step-free access makes it easy to reach by public transport, including for those with mobility needs.
